7、u about it. Britain:The official name of the nation known as Britain is the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land. The United Kingdom, or U.K., consists of Great Britain (i.e. the large island that is made up of England, Scotland and Wales), Northern Ireland, and a lot of coastal isla

8、nds (The Isle of Wight, Anglsey, the Hebrides, Orkney and Shetland, and others). England is just the largest country in the United Kingdom. Warming up by brainstormingGood morning, class.
